I colocate all my servers that all run FreeBSD.
Myself has been through generational hardware, and had had zero issues with any apart from when the raid card failed.
Network has been solid. ZFS has just worked. Not sure what your issues were however colocating since FreeBSD 8, and now colocating 16-CURRENT on my the server. FreeBSD has been rock stable in my books.
2x Dell R630 and 1x Cisco U220 M5
doublerabbit@cookie:~ $ uname -a && uptime
FreeBSD cookie.server 12.2-BETA1 FreeBSD 12.2-BETA1 r365618 GENERIC amd64
10:39PM up 1752 days, 1:31, 1 user, load averages: 0.64, 1.30, 1.31
